Spring Luau

Saturday April 9th, 2011 the Chi Eta Chapter hosted its first spring philanthropy event. The inaugural Bowling Green Spring Luau was held to raise money for Big Brothers Big Sisters of South Central Kentucky. The event took place at Bruster’s Real Ice Cream on Scottsville Road. Date a Delta

April 15, 2010 No Comments by WKU Fiji

The Delta pledge class held the ever first Date a Delta event Wednesday April 14, 2010 in the Mass Media Auditorium. The philanthropic event raised funds to go towards Fiji’s Across America, which is benefiting Alzheimer’s research.
